Français : Plaque-boucle,époque mérovingienne,7ème s. +JC:bronze étamé, décor gravé avec motifs de vannerie et tête du Christ. Musée St-Remi à Reims (51), France.
English: Merovingian buckle, 7th century; bronze plated with tin, decorated with a basketwork pattern and the Christ's head.Musée Saint-Remi, Reims, France. |
